[ http://issues.apache.org/jira/browse/DERBY-212?page=all ] Knut Anders Hatlen reopened DERBY-212: --------------------------------------
Assign To: Dyre Tjeldvoll (was: Knut Anders Hatlen) Reopening the issue since my patch didn't address everything mentioned in the description. Dyre has started optimizing parseSQLDTA_work(), so I reassign the issue to him. > Optimize some specific methods in Network Server to improve performance > ----------------------------------------------------------------------- > > Key: DERBY-212 > URL: http://issues.apache.org/jira/browse/DERBY-212 > Project: Derby > Type: Improvement > Components: Network Server, Performance > Versions: 10.1.1.0 > Reporter: Kathey Marsden > Assignee: Dyre Tjeldvoll > Priority: Minor > Attachments: DERBY-212-parsePKGNAMCSN-2.diff, throughput-normalized.png, > throughput.png > > In reviewing the Network Server Code and profiling there were > several areas that showed potential for providing performance > improvement. > Functions that need optimizing to prevent unneeded object > creation and excessive decoding > parsePKGNAMCSN() > parseSQLDTA_work() > buildDB2CursorName() > In DDMWriter and DDMReader, use System Routines in > java.util.Arrays and System.arrayCopy instead of > writing code to do functions like copy arrays and > pad strings. -- This message is automatically generated by JIRA. - If you think it was sent incorrectly contact one of the administrators: http://issues.apache.org/jira/secure/Administrators.jspa - For more information on JIRA, see: http://www.atlassian.com/software/jira